The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Gloucestershire requiring ERP sk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the annual salaries offered in vacancies that cited ERP over the 6 months leading up to 11 June 2024,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
11 Jun 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 111 90 110
Rank change year-on-year -21 +20 -18
Permanent jobs citing ERP 24 25 26
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Gloucestershire 1.28% 2.09% 1.79%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 1.52% 2.15% 1.85%
Number of salaries quoted 20 21 24
10th Percentile £34,750 £32,500 -
25th Percentile £40,625 £52,500 £37,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£61,500 £55,000 £47,500
Median % change year-on-year +11.82% +15.79% +8.57%
75th Percentile £70,438 £60,800 £57,188
90th Percentile £95,000 £62,500 £69,250
South West median annual salary £54,500 £55,000 £47,500
% change year-on-year -0.91% +15.79% +5.56%
